What does Batiste mean and where does it come from?
Batiste is a variant of Baptiste, derived from the Greek name 'Baptistēs', meaning 'one who baptizes'.
Cultural significance
The name is commonly used in French-speaking regions and is often associated with religious significance due to its connection to John the Baptist.
